First published in 2006, the book quickly became an essential resource for those seeking sounds beyond the mainstream 1960s and 70s rock scene. While many collectors are familiar with heavyweights like The Thirteenth Floor Elevators , Lundborg’s work dives deeper into "outsider" albums and vanity pressings that were often unknown even to contemporary listeners.
